Inconsistent field titles: "Technical Name" in "Export Package" pop-up vs "Name" in "Inspector" window
h5. How to reproduce:
1. Create a project
2. Window -> Package Management -> Package Manager
3. Click “+” and select “Create package”
4. Enter the package name and click the “Create”
5. Select the newly created package in the Package Manager window
6. Observe package fields in the "Inspector" window
7. Return to the Package Manager window
8. Click the "Export" button
9. Observe fields in the pop-up
h5. Expected results:
Field names should be consistent. It should be "Technical Name" when the inspector is in read only mode. When in edit mode, keep "name" since the technical name is split in 2 fields then.
h5. Actual results:
In the "Export Package" pop-up, we see the title "Technical Name", but in the "Inspector" window, we see the title "Name".
h5. Reproducible with:
6000.3.0a5, 6000.3.0b2
h5. Can't test with:
6000.3.0a4 as this build has "Export" functionality
h5. Tested on (OS):
M1 Max - Sequoia 15.6.1
